Callaway Big Bertha Driver Review

My Big Bertha finally arrived at quarter to 7 this evening, too late for the local range as they close at 6:30. I was not planning to play tomorrow as I have a 3 day tournament coming up on Thursday, Friday & Saturday but it looks like I will be hitting the range for a while in the morning to dial this lady in.
 
Got in 9 holes this evening with the BB. This is only my second nine hole round since #theking. I tried several different settings with the BB on the range: 11.5 degree, 10.5 degree, 9.5 degree. I've got a really big draw working most of the time with the girl so I'd like to work that out. The 9.5 degree setting produced the least draw but it was such a low trajectory that I was losing carry distance. I settled on 10.5 degree, neutral setting, with the perimeter weighting set on "2" towards fade. I really wish this driver had adjustability to set the face open instead of just the neutral or draw setting. Maybe that will come in the next generation.

I hit 5 of 6 fairways with the BB on the 6 holes I played her on, so it is working out for me. One of those was a pop up though that only went about 200 yards. Distance seems similar to the SLDR. SLDR is quite a bit straighter for me right now though. I'll spend some more time with BB though and see if I can't get used to her.

And it is now in the bag. Ended up setting it to +2 D and moving the slider weight over 1 mark to the fade side. Perfect. I hit it slightly farther than the X-Hot, maybe 5-7 yards, but mainly I hit it straighter than the X-Hot and that was really a surprise as I hit a high percentage of fairways already. I thoroughly enjoyed the feedback from my moderate (Hi 80s to lo 90s) swing speed brethren here. I think I'm going to get the BB Driver and maybe a fairway (I love the shallow face for off the deck shots).
My question for my moderate SS friends is what flex are you playing in the BB? I tend to get regular flex in everything, but a local shop taped up a stiff flex to demo since it was all they had in stock. For some reason, it turns out it wasn't the regular stiff flex 50 ZT shaft but it was the 60ZT shaft for the Alpha. I hit it pretty well (maybe even better than a couple of demo day sessions at R fleet +1, draw biased weight setting( with no control issues, but the ball flight was a little lower than I wanted. However, I felt like I could go after it a little harder without losing it right or left. It was a 10.5* at +2 N with neutral slide weighting. So, now I'm wondering if a stiff flex in the normal BB shaft might work best. I'll try both flexes again before buying, but any thoughts and feedback would be appreciated.
